Skip to content

HexDumpされたものを元のバイナリデータ形式で抽出

Notifications You must be signed in to change notification settings

s-horiguchi/hexdump2bin

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 
 
 

Repository files navigation

hexdump2bin

What's this?

$ python hexdump2bin.py -h
Usage: ./hexdump2bin.py [options] IN_FILE OUT_FILE

Options:
  -h, --help  show this help message and exit

IN_FILEに、hexdumpなどによって出力されたバイナリデータのアスキー文字列を指定すると、
OUT_FILEに元のバイナリデータを抽出します。 hexdumpの同じ内容が連続した行を*で省略する機能にも対応。

Example

こんなかんじで使います。

$ hexdump /bin/ls > ls_org.hex
$ python hexdump2bin.py ls_org.hex ls.bin
[*] Reading from ls_org.hex
[*] Analyzing...
[*] Dumping to ls.bin
$ diff /bin/ls ls.bin 
$ 

About

HexDumpされたものを元のバイナリデータ形式で抽出

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ages